The NYT Strands spangram for February 16, 2026 (puzzle #715) is FIGURESKATING, a 13-letter answer to the theme "The cutting edge". The 7 theme words are COMBO, CROSSOVER, JUMP, LIFT, LOOP, SPIN and THROW.

Strands puzzle #715 was edited by Tracy Bennett and constructed by Christina Iverson. Output across the whole run is broken down on who makes NYT Strands.
